diff --git a/src/game/WorldSession.cpp b/src/game/WorldSession.cpp index 491de312c..4bc0aa7d1 100644 --- a/src/game/WorldSession.cpp +++ b/src/game/WorldSession.cpp @@ -171,7 +171,7 @@ bool WorldSession::Update(uint32 /*diff*/) packet->GetOpcode()); #endif*/ - OpcodeHandler& opHandle = opcodeTable[packet->GetOpcode()]; + OpcodeHandler const& opHandle = opcodeTable[packet->GetOpcode()]; try { switch (opHandle.status) @@ -860,7 +860,7 @@ void WorldSession::SendRedirectClient(std::string& ip, uint16 port) SendPacket(&pkt); } -void WorldSession::ExecuteOpcode( OpcodeHandler& opHandle, WorldPacket* packet ) +void WorldSession::ExecuteOpcode( OpcodeHandler const& opHandle, WorldPacket* packet ) { // need prevent do internal far teleports in handlers because some handlers do lot steps // or call code that can do far teleports in some conditions unexpectedly for generic way work code diff --git a/src/game/WorldSession.h b/src/game/WorldSession.h index 23ae01646..af857e236 100644 --- a/src/game/WorldSession.h +++ b/src/game/WorldSession.h @@ -775,7 +775,7 @@ class MANGOS_DLL_SPEC WorldSession // private trade methods void moveItems(Item* myItems[], Item* hisItems[]); - void ExecuteOpcode( OpcodeHandler& opHandle, WorldPacket* packet ); + void ExecuteOpcode( OpcodeHandler const& opHandle, WorldPacket* packet ); // logging helper void LogUnexpectedOpcode(WorldPacket *packet, const char * reason); diff --git a/src/shared/revision_nr.h b/src/shared/revision_nr.h index a6b664f8b..b10cee29d 100644 --- a/src/shared/revision_nr.h +++ b/src/shared/revision_nr.h @@ -1,4 +1,4 @@ #ifndef __REVISION_NR_H__ #define __REVISION_NR_H__ - #define REVISION_NR "10077" + #define REVISION_NR "10078" #endif // __REVISION_NR_H__